The Blogosphere and the Holidays
The Blogosphere and the Holidays
12/20/2003 06:16 AM
First, if this time of year makes you cheerful, have a happy.
I'm pretty ambivalent. There are some things I like and some things I
don't. I see the pressure to buy for what it is. Pressure, which I
don't like, and commercialism, which I also don't like. I love buying
nice things, but almost no one knows how to do that for me like I do.
I suspect that's true of everyone.
One of the things I like about this time of year is that so
many people seem to have a time to do interesting and fun things. It's
like everyone gets a mini-sabbatical. It's time to go to a game, to
the movies, a museum, out to a long lunch or visit with a few bloggers
you haven't stayed in touch with. Next week I'm going to be in NYC.
Maybe there will be an opportunity to do some or all of that.
Randy Charles Morin sent a question about this. Does the
blogosphere pick up or go on holiday during the holidays? Here's what
I said.
1. I don't have any data, but I do have subjectives.
2. The actual flow goes down, around the 25th way down.
3. But the volume of real work goes up, because people have
time for projects that require attention or thinking, which they have
more of in the coming two-three weeks.
I've done some of my best work in this period in years past. My
first two XML projects, siteChanges.xml and scriptingNews format
(which became half of RSS 0.91) were hatched in December. Last year in
this time period I helped my parents get through a tough time. I was
telling my brother yesterday that I have fond memories of this, it
gave me a strong sense of purpose, and a sense that I made a
difference. That also happened during the holidays last year.
So mostly the holidays are good. I especially like it when
stress isn't a big part of it.

Winter holidays in Russia.
12/22/2003 10:06 PMIn Russia, winter holidays are celebrated somewhat differently than in
the United States and most of the West. Although the underlying
substance of the winter holidays -- presents, trees, family
gatherings -- is the same, it corresponds to different holidays and
customs. This results from a blend of Russian national tradition,
the influence of Eastern Orthodox heritage and of course, Soviet
secularisation. There is a lot more to be said about this than is
actually practical, so I would like to focus on two axial aspects
that sit comfortably within my sphere of knowledge: New Year and the
custom of giving presents. The latter topic is a little more
editorial than encyclopedic, but please bear with me. Also, please
understand that none of this information is in any way
"authoritative." I tell you all this as a Russian immigrant, not as a
cultural anthropologist or otherwise a person bearing any
credentials or officialdom.

Are Paperless Holidays Good?
Are Paperless Holidays Good?
12/15/2003 03:33 AMNow that the holiday season is in full swing, some are wondering if
the trend to move away from paper holiday cards and letters is
taking away from the
concept. If it's the thought that counts, does it count less when
the end result is easier/cheaper or less personalized? Part of this
sounds like typical complaining about the "less personal" feel of some
new technologies. Just like many things, I think it has advantages
and disadvantages. Certainly, in some instances it seems less
personal. Also, going completely electronic means that some people
will never see your message thanks to spam filters and fear of
viruses. However, it also can make it easier to communicate with some
people. Already this year I've received two electronic holiday notes
from friends who I'm sure I wouldn't have heard from otherwise. The
ease of email/web communications made sure I got included and lets me
know what they're up to, and reminds me to drop them a separate note
to see how they're doing. While it would be great if we could all
write deeply personal notes to everyone we know, the ease of internet
communications makes it possible to stay in touch with those who
you're not as close with, but who are still worth keeping as friends.
